CVE-2023-1080

31
FAUCET Score

CVE-2023-1080 is a Reflected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ability affecting the GN Publisher plugin for WordPress, specifically versions up to and including 1.5.5. This flaw stems from insufficient input sanitization and output escaping of the ‘tab’ parameter, allowing unauthenticated attackers to inject malicious web scripts.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 6.1 (Medium), indicating a low attack complexity and the potential for limited impact on confidentiality and integrity if a user is tricked into clicking a malicious link. While there is no evidence of active exploitation or Metasploit modules, Nuclei templates exist for detection, and the CVE has received minimal community discussion or media coverage.
